Economics Professor Walter Enders Selected for UA’s Prestigious Blackmon-Moody Award

Dr. Walter Enders, professor of economics and Lee Bidgood Chair of Economics and Finance, has been selected as the 2004 recipient of The University of Alabama’s Frederick Moody Blackmon-Sarah McCorkle Moody Outstanding Professor Award.

UA Enrollment at Record High; Freshman Class Up 9.4 Percent

Enrollment at The University of Alabama is at an all-time high of 20,969 students this fall, with both the entering freshman class and new graduate students representing some of the largest and best qualified classes in UA history.
